Sydney International Regatta Centre
A spectacular event venue for either 10 or 30,000 people, the Sydney International Regatta Centre offers superior event facilities and is one of the region’s premier outdoor sport and entertainment venues for both on and off the water.
Only an hour’s drive northwest of Sydney CBD, the Sydney International Regatta Centre was purpose-built for the 2000 Sydney Olympics and Paralympics. It is one of the best rowing and sprint kayak courses in the world and sprawls over 178 scenic hectares boasting scenic views of Penrith Lakes, the Lower Blue Mountains and surrounding parkland.
This naturally beautiful setting offers a vast selection of event facilities including:
- Large island with a capacity of 20,000 (depending on overlay)
- Whole of venue capacity of 30,000 (up to 50,000 subject to approval of application)
- Multiple conference rooms with state-of-the-art audio-visual equipment
- Spectator pavilion with 1,000 seat capacity
- Outdoor and undercover exhibition areas
- Village green and a range of large outdoor spaces
- 2300m competition lake and 1500m warm up lake
- On water access with launch pontoons
- 5km cycling loop and 5km running path
- Swim lane and open water swim course
- Cross country running course
- Parking for 2,000 vehicles and coach and shuttle set-down and pick-up stations
